WebThe function we passed to the Array.findIndex method gets called with each object in the array. On each iteration, we check if the id property of the object has a value equal to 4. If it does, we return true and get the index of the matching object. If there is no object that satisfies the condition, the findIndex method returns -1. WebDec 14, 2024 · The Javascript Array.findIndex () method is used to return the first index of the element in a given array that satisfies the provided testing function (passed in by the user while calling). Otherwise, if no data is found then the value of -1 is returned. It does not execute the method once it finds an element satisfying the testing method.
